----Also sorry to hear this, Steve! Seems he really enjoyed his life. What type of boat racing did Rick partake in if I can ask?......Bill S
He held the single engine powerboat record for circumnavigating Long Island, I believe. The record was never broken. He also had a speedboat with twin 409s in it. As well as a number of L88 powered boats. I remember he showed me a photo of their record breaking run and he was at the helm and his partner was hanging halfway over the front of the boat like a masthead, to add weight to balance the nose. Imagine doing that for any length of time is insane.

EDIT: I just googled the record and it looks like it was finally broken last year by a 17 year old kid after 54 years on the books!
